【发布时间】:2022-01-05 22:45:44
【问题描述】:
Appium 桌面版:1.21.0 iPhone 6:iOS 12.4.8(更新 12.5.5 待定但未安装) MacBook:11.6
你好,
我正在尝试在 iPhone 6 上运行脚本。我能够在新年前在多个应用程序上运行它,现在当我尝试运行它时,我在 Appium 日志中遇到了几个错误。
我没有更新 Mac、Appium、iPhone 或应用程序本身的任何内容。我在想也许有些东西在新的一年过期了,但我不知道是什么或在哪里。这些错误是关于证书的,但我不确定在哪里寻找它。应用程序团队表示他们方面没有任何改变。 非常感谢任何帮助。
提前致谢。
installApplicationBundleAtPath:withOptions:andError:withCallback: 失败 { [Xcode] NSLocalizedDescription = "无法安装 "WebDriverAgentRunner-Runner""; [Xcode] NSLocalizedRecoverySuggestion = "用于签名的证书 “WebDriverAgentRunner-Runner”已过期或已过期 撤销。需要更新的证书来签署和安装 应用。”; [Xcode] NSUnderlyingError = "错误 Domain=com.apple.dt.MobileDeviceErrorDomain Code=-402620392 "的 用于签署可执行文件的身份不再有效。”
[Xcode] ), DVTRadarComponentKey=487925, NSLocalizedDescription=The 用于签署可执行文件的身份不再有效。}}, NSLocalizedDescription=无法安装 "WebDriverAgentRunner-Runner", NSLocalizedRecoverySuggestion=The 用于签署“WebDriverAgentRunner-Runner”的证书具有 已过期或已被撤销。需要更新的证书 签署并安装应用程序。}
[Xcode] 找不到签名证书“iOS 开发”:没有“iOS 开发”签名证书匹配团队ID“********”与 找到了私钥。 [Xcode] 没有配置文件 'com.facebook.WebDriverAgentRunner.xctrunner' 被发现:Xcode 找不到任何匹配的 iOS 应用程序开发配置文件 'com.facebook.WebDriverAgentRunner.xctrunner'。自动签名是 已禁用且无法生成配置文件。启用自动 签名,将 -allowProvisioningUpdates 传递给 xcodebuild
自动签名,将 -allowProvisioningUpdates 传递给 xcodebuild。 [Xcode] WebDriverAgentRunner: [Xcode] WebDriverAgentRunner-Runner 遇到错误(无法安装或启动测试运行程序。如果 您认为此错误代表错误,请附上结果 捆绑在 /Users/testingmacbook2/Library/ 开发人员/Xcode/DerivedData/WebDriverAgentfvxubjhhmibljkavzmyifigxrumc/Logs/Test/TestWebDriverAgentRunner-2022.01.05_10-40-25-+0000.xcresult。 (根本错误:无法安装“WebDriverAgentRunner-Runner”。 用于签署“WebDriverAgentRunner-Runner”的证书具有 已过期或已被撤销。需要更新的证书 签名并安装应用程序。 (根本错误:身份 用于签署可执行文件不再有效。))) [Xcode] [Xcode] ** 测试执行失败 ** [Xcode] [Xcode] [Xcode] 测试开始 [Xcode] [WebDriverAgent] xcodebuild 以代码 '65' 和信号退出 '空'
【问题讨论】:
-
可以添加目标签名和能力的截图吗?